JX Advanced Metals Corp 2021 Sustainability Report
The report describes the Group's formal 50% CO2 reduction target by fiscal 2030 against fiscal 2018 and net zero by fiscal 2050. It reports fiscal 2020 Scope 1+2 emissions of 1,345 kt, down from 1,811 kt in 2018, alongside the Carbon Free Project and major-site conversion to CO2-free electricity. The report also sets a 50% recycled-materials ratio goal for copper smelting by 2040 and reports 9,887 consolidated employees and 1,092.1 billion yen of consolidated revenue.
